The Nortiv 8 Men’s Side Zipper Tactical Boot is constructed using a durable leather material that is resistant to abrasions, allowing you to go through demanding environments without worrying that the fabric will easily be destroyed when exposed to abrasive surfaces. The upper is fitted with breathable panels that allow air to move freely throughout the boot to maintain proper ventilation and prevent extreme heat from producing significant discomfort. The heavy-duty rubber outsole is designed with aggressive lugs that grip the ground firmly so that you can walk safely on challenging surface conditions without worrying that every step can lead to a slipping accident. The boots are equipped with an EVA midsole that flexes with your movements so that you can move as naturally as possible without compromising your agility, which is important especially during crucial moments when your or others’ safety is at stake. A flexible foam insole likewise moves with your steps, so you can do the activities that are required without anything interfering with your actions. This foam insole keeps your feet lovingly cushioned to ease pressure points and prevent blisters from forming throughout the day while ensuring that foot fatigue is stopped from developing even with your constant movements. Look for boots with a tough outer shell made from leather or synthetic materials, with double or triple-stitched seams for added strength. Rubber: It's the most common and reliable material for providing grip. It resists wear and offers slip resistance on various surfaces. Width: Boots that are too narrow can cause blisters, while those that are too wide won't provide enough support. Some brands offer various widths. Keep in mind that less padding means a lesser weight of boots, but you don’t want to compromise comfort. Find the right balance of comfort and protection.
